10 <br />RECOMMENDED CONDITIONS OF APPROVAL <br />If the City Council wishes to the CUP request, city staff recommends the following conditions of <br />approval: <br />1)Prior to issuance of City permits for the project: <br />a)Stormwater Management: A stormwater management plan meeting all State, Watershed <br />District and City rules is required and a permit must be obtained from the Valley Branch <br />Watershed District. These required details must be included. <br />i.Soil borings will be required for infiltration basins. <br />ii.If adjacent properties are impacted by stormwater discharge, written permission <br />from those property owners is required. <br />iii.The storm water facilities must remain privately owned and maintained. <br />iv.A Stormwater Maintenance and Easement Agreement in the City’s standard <br />form is required. <br />b)The applicant must provide to the City Engineer a statement from a qualified engineer <br />certifying the foundation and design of the solar panels, racking and support is within <br />accepted professional standards, given local soil and climate conditions. <br />c)A revised landscape plan should be submitted to address the Landscape Architects memo <br />dated March 13th 2023 and address reduced tree spacing. <br />d)The applicant must provide an approved interconnection agreement with Xcel. <br />e)The applicant must provide to the Fire Department details about the proposed gate to <br />ensure it is in compliance with the fire code. <br />f)The applicant must provide a letter of credit in the amount of $120,652 for <br />decommissioning the site. The letter of credit must be in good standing at all times and <br />issued by a bank determined by the City to be solvent and creditworthy. The letter of <br />credit shall be in a form approved by the City. In the event the letter of credit is not <br />renewed or is cancelled, the City may revoke the conditional use permit. <br />g)The applicant must obtain all other necessary City, State, and other governing body <br />permits prior to the commencement of any construction activity on the parcel including <br />but not limited to an approved stormwater management plan, utility plans, grading plan, <br />and building permits. <br />2)General: <br />a)The applicant must install a Fire Department lock box for emergency access to the site at <br />an approved location and provide keys for emergency access into the property and any <br />controls necessary for emergency use or shut down. <br />b)The modules and equipment on the site must be removed within 90 days after the site is <br />no longer operational or has not operated continuously for 12 months. In the event that it <br />is not removed by that time, the City has permission to enter the property to remove it <br />and recover its costs from the letter of credit.
